Prerequisites
While the title screams “Beginners,” let’s be real: “beginner” in the tech world often means “beginner *to this specific technology*.” You’re going to have an easier time if you come in with a basic understanding of a few things:
- General computing concepts: Knowing what a server is, how websites work (HTTP, DNS), and basic networking ideas (IP addresses, ports) will make the AWS concepts click much faster.
- Familiarity with the command line: You won’t be writing complex scripts, but comfortable navigation and executing commands in a terminal will serve you well.
- Basic programming logic (optional but helpful): Especially when you hit the serverless sections with AWS Lambda. You don’t need to be a coding wizard, but understanding what functions do and how they interact with APIs will make that module far less daunting.
If you’re starting from absolute zero with computers, you might find the pace a bit aggressive in spots, but it’s certainly not insurmountable with a bit of extra effort and external research.

Career Benefits & Job Roles
Look, AWS skills are not just “nice to have” anymore; they’re table stakes for a huge chunk of the tech industry. This course is an excellent springboard for several career paths:
- Cloud Engineer / DevOps Engineer: The foundational knowledge in EC2, VPC, S3, and load balancing directly translates to these roles, especially if you’re keen on infrastructure provisioning and automation.
- Solutions Architect (Associate Level): While not a direct certification prep course, the project-based learning and exposure to various services provide a fantastic practical base for tackling the AWS Certified Solutions Architect β Associate exam. You’ll understand *why* certain architectural choices are made.
- Backend Developer (with a Serverless focus): If you’re a developer looking to build scalable, cost-effective backends without managing servers, the Lambda and API Gateway sections will be invaluable.
- IT Administrator / System Administrator: Transitioning traditional IT roles to the cloud is easier with this kind of practical exposure.
Ultimately, gaining proficiency with these services significantly boosts your career growth potential in a cloud-first world, enabling you to confidently apply for roles that demand hands-on AWS experience.
